Smart Timing: Planning Furnace Replacement Before 2028
For many homeowners, addressing a furnace replacement sooner rather than later offers peace of mind and improved energy efficiency. If your furnace is aging or recurrent repair issues have become the norm, now might be the ideal time to evaluate its performance. Replacing an old or problematic unit can prevent unexpected failures during harsh winter months and enhance overall indoor comfort—especially in regions like Kennesaw, Georgia, where seasonal temperature swings are common.
Consider these practical indicators:
Frequent Repairs: Ongoing issues or rising maintenance costs signal that your furnace may be nearing the end of its reliable life.
Reduced Efficiency: An outdated system can consume more energy, leading to higher utility bills and diminished performance.
Irregular Heating: Inconsistent heating patterns often hint at underlying mechanical problems that could worsen over time.
Safety Concerns: Persistent malfunctions may compromise safe operation, putting your home at risk.
By assessing these factors early, homeowners can schedule a timely upgrade, ensuring a seamless transition to a more efficient and dependable heating system ahead of 2028. This proactive approach minimizes disruption and supports long-term savings while keeping your household comfortable year after year.
Upgrading Your 95% Efficiency Furnace: A Step-by-Step Guide
Navigating the installation of a 95% efficiency furnace involves careful planning and practical solutions. Follow these steps to ensure a smooth upgrade that meets modern standards while addressing local installation challenges:
Evaluate Your Current System:
Begin by assessing your existing furnace setup. Identify limitations in venting and airflow that may not support a high-efficiency unit. A close look at ductwork and clearance requirements is crucial.
Understand Code and Installation Modifications:
Check local building codes in regions like Kennesaw, Georgia, as they often require specific alterations for high-efficiency furnaces. This may include adjustments to venting systems or additional insulation.
Plan for Additional Components:
High-efficiency furnaces sometimes need modified condensate drainage and upgraded controls. Create a detailed list of components that require replacement or enhancement to ensure optimal performance.
Consult a Qualified Professional:
Schedule a thorough inspection with a trusted HVAC expert. Their advice can guide you on necessary modifications, proper installation practices, and energy-saving tips.
By following these actionable steps, you can confidently update your furnace system, ensuring energy efficiency and sustained comfort for years to come.
